- Define, gather, and analyze system and customer requirements.
- Ability to see the business needs through system requirements for smooth implementation of projects.
- Develop system deliverables in requirements format.
- Work with business clients to document, review, revise, estimate and prioritize requirements.
- Work with developers to plan, develop and design to ensure requirements are being met.
- Resolve any requirements issues.
- Work with testers and review test plans/ test cases to ensure requirements are thoroughly tested.
- Coordinate defect resolution with developers and testers and ensure retest fixes any issues.
- Assist with user training and User Acceptance testing (UAT) and documentation of training material development.
- Business Analysts must be competent to work on complex projects and or multiple projects simultaneously, with the ability organize and manage project work to drive predictable delivery.
- The incumbents may also provide guidance to, and assist in training less experienced staff.
